Revitalisation of Historic Buildings

Historic buildings are a symbol of our collective identity, as well as carriers of history and culture, having witnessed the territory’s changes and development. The revitalisation process involves not just renovating historic buildings, but also continuing and deepening their social function to reintegrate them into modern society.

In 2008, the Development Bureau launched the "Revitalising Historic Buildings Through Partnership Scheme". With subsidies from the government, non-profit organisations are encouraged to revitalise suitable government-owned historic buildings for creative use. The scheme has so far been launched in five phases, with a total of fifteen historic building revitalisation projects approved. Up to 2016, about 2.6 million people have visited the completed projects. Four of the projects received the Award of Merit or Honourable Mention in the “UNESCO Asia-Pacific Awards for Cultural Heritage Conservation”, including the “Tai O Heritage Hotel”, a revitalisation of the Old Tai O Police Station, the “YHA Mei Ho House Youth Hostel”, a revitalisation of the former Mei Ho House and the “Green Hub”, a revitalisation of the Old Tai Po Police Station, etc. Some private owners have also revitalised their historic buildings; for example, the “F11 Photographic Museum" has been revitalised from a Grade 3 historic building at 11 Yuk Sau Street, Happy Valley.

These revitalisation projects have put historic buildings to productive use, giving them a continuing role in our community and creating quality and diverse cultural space.
